Are commercials
still
recorded
on
the
tape
in
case
1
choose
to
view
them sometime?
Yes.
By
setting
the
C/A
PLAYBACK
to
MANU(a!),
see
page
26,
you can view
or
advance
through
commercials as
desired.
Does
COMMERCIAL
ADVANCE™
work
in
all
recording
speeds?
Yes.
COMMERCIAL
ADVANCE™
works
in
SP,
LP.
and SLP.
Does
the
VCR
advance
through
commercials
each
time
1
playback tapes which
were
recorded
using
COMMERCIAL
ADVANCE™
?
Yes.
As
long
as
C/A
PLAYBACK
is
set
to
AUTO,
see
page
26, the
VCR
should
advance
through
commercials
each
time the tape
is
played back.
After
marking commercials,
does
the
VCR
stop
at
the
end
of
the tape, or
rewind
to
the
beginning?
The
tape stops
at
the
end
of
the recording
so
that
any
additional timer
recordings
can be
performed.

Will
play
in
non-COMMERCIAL
ADVANCE™
VCRs,
but
commercials
will
not
be advanced
through.
Does
the
marking process
interfere
with other
programmed
recordings?
No.
If
the
interval
between
2
or
more
timer
programs
is
not
sufficient
to
mark
the
recording,
marking
will
be
done
after
all
recordings are
complete
and
the
power
goes
off.
What
happens
if
1
cancel
the
marking
in
progress
so
1
can use
the
VCR?
Marking
will
be resumed
when
the
VCR
s
power
is
turned
off
as
long
as
the
tape
has
not
been
ejected.
What
if
part of
my
program
is
advanced
through
along
with the
commercials?
Rewind
the
tape
to
where
the
program
should
have
started,
and push
PLAY
to
view
the
program.
Can
1
mark a
recording
that
was
made
an
another
VCR?
Yes.
See
"Marking
an
Unmarked
Tape" on page
25.
Additional
Notes:
Because
of
the various
ways
in
which commercials
are broadcast, the
VCR
may
not
be
able
to
recognize
all
commercials.
If
a
timer recording
is
scheduled
for
the
middle
of
the
night,
please
be aware
that
the
VCR
will
make some
noise
as
it
rewinds
and
fast
fonwards
the
tape
while
marking commercials.
